The Challenge of Spectrum Scarcity
The wireless spectrum is a finite resource, and as technological advancements unfold, its scarcity has led to a pivotal industry debate. Enterprises today are exploring the potential of Citizen Broadband Radio Service (CBRS) as a solution to maximize the usage of this precious resource. Pat Rudolph's presentation will address how real-time, AI-enabled radio frequency (RF) awareness can revolutionize the utilization of shared spectrum, paving the way for unprecedented innovation in 6G technology.
Understanding AI-Enabled RF Awareness
DGS has developed cutting-edge technology that employs AI and machine learning to enhance RF awareness. This advancement aims to make spectrum sharing more sustainable and effective. Pat will discuss how these technologies allow for the detection, classification, and geolocation of RF signals, which are crucial for enabling dynamic spectrum management.

About Digital Global Systems (DGS)
Headquartered in northern Virginia, DGS has positioned itself as a leader in addressing the challenges posed by wireless spectrum scarcity. Since its founding, it has accrued over 292 patents that underscore its innovative prowess in RF signal management. The combination of AI capabilities and machine learning tools enhances users’ access and awareness of critical RF data, improving service delivery and minimizing interference.
